Publisher's description

From Un4seen Developments :

XMPlay is a Windows music player, supporting the OGG / MP3 / MP2 / MP1 / WMA / WAV / MO3 / IT / XM / S3M / MTM / MOD / UMX audio formats, and PLS / M3U / ASX playlists. A load more formats are also supported via Winamp plugins. Many nice features, like streaming from FTP / HTTP / Shoutcast / Icecast servers, skins, disk writing.
